Ingredients for Irresistible Sirloin Tip Roast
- 3 pounds beef sirloin tip roast
- 1 tablespoon olive oil
- 2 teaspoons kosher salt
- 1 teaspoon freshly ground black pepper
- 1 teaspoon garlic powder
- 1 teaspoon onion powder
- 1 sprig fresh rosemary or ½ teaspoon dried rosemary
Step-by-Step Instructions
- Preheat your oven to 400°F (200°C) and let your roast come to room temperature for 15 minutes—this ensures even cooking.
- Pat the sirloin tip roast dry. Rub it all over with olive oil, then season generously with salt, pepper, garlic powder, onion powder, and rosemary.
- Secure the roast: Tie cooking twine around the meat at 1½-inch intervals to maintain its shape during roasting.
- Heat a large oven-safe skillet or roasting pan over medium-high heat. Sear the roast on all sides until golden brown (about 2 minutes per side).
- Transfer the pan to the preheated oven and roast for 60–75 minutes, or until an instant-read thermometer inserted into the thickest part reads 135°F for medium-rare.
- Rest the roast: Remove from the oven, tent with foil, and let rest 15 minutes. This locks in the juices for ultra-tender slices.
- Slice thinly against the grain and serve hot, or chill and layer on mini party rolls with mustard for delicious cold sandwiches.
Serving Suggestions & Expert Tips
- Make-ahead magic: Leftover slices are perfect for salads, wraps, or sliders.
- Flavor boost: Deglaze the roasting pan with a splash of red wine or beef broth for a quick pan sauce.
- Party friendly: Serve cold sirloin tip roast on crostini with a dollop of horseradish cream.
Nutrition & Yields
Servings: 6 | Total Time: 1 h 45 m | Prep Time: 10 m | Cook Time: 1 h 35 m
Calories: 299 kcal | Protein: 48 g | Fat: 10 g | Carbs: 1 g | Sodium: 132 mg
